"""Test that forward declaration of a data structure gets resolved correctly."""
import os, time
import unittest2
import lldb
from lldbtest import *
class ForwardDeclarationTestCase(TestBase):
mydir = "forward"
@unittest2.skipUnless(sys.platform.startswith("darwin"), "requires Darwin")
def test_with_dsym_and_run_command(self):
"""Display *bar_ptr when stopped on a function with forward declaration of struct bar."""
self.buildDsym()
self.forward_declaration()
# rdar://problem/8648070
# 'expression *bar_ptr' seg faults
# rdar://problem/8546815
# './dotest.py -v -t forward' fails for test_with_dwarf_and_run_command
def test_with_dwarf_and_run_command(self):
"""Display *bar_ptr when stopped on a function with forward declaration of struct bar."""
self.buildDwarf()
self.forward_declaration()
def forward_declaration(self):
"""Display *bar_ptr when stopped on a function with forward declaration of struct bar."""
exe = os.path.join(os.getcwd(), "a.out")
self.runCmd("file " + exe, CURRENT_EXECUTABLE_SET)
# Break inside the foo function which takes a bar_ptr argument.
self.expect("breakpoint set -n foo", BREAKPOINT_CREATED,
startstr = "Breakpoint created: 1: name = 'foo', locations = 1")
self.runCmd("run", RUN_SUCCEEDED)
# The stop reason of the thread should be breakpoint.
self.expect("thread list", STOPPED_DUE_TO_BREAKPOINT,
substrs = ['state is stopped',
'stop reason = breakpoint'])
# The breakpoint should have a hit count of 1.
self.expect("breakpoint list", BREAKPOINT_HIT_ONCE,
substrs = [' resolved, hit count = 1'])
# This should display correctly.
# Note that the member fields of a = 1 and b = 2 is by design.
self.expect("frame variable -t *bar_ptr", VARIABLES_DISPLAYED_CORRECTLY,
substrs = ['(struct bar) *bar_ptr = ',
'(int) a = 1',
'(int) b = 2'])
# And so should this.
self.expect("expression *bar_ptr", VARIABLES_DISPLAYED_CORRECTLY,
substrs = ['(struct bar)',
'(int) a = 1',
'(int) b = 2'])
if __name__ == '__main__':
import atexit
lldb.SBDebugger.Initialize()
atexit.register(lambda: lldb.SBDebugger.Terminate())
unittest2.main()
